Punjab Chief Minister Bhagwant Mann and his wife Gurpreet Kaur were blessed with a baby girl today Sharing the news on X (previously known as Twitter), the Chief Minister said that both the mother and the newborn are doing fine. In the post, the Chief Minister wrote [originally in Punjabi]: “God has given the gift of a daughter...Both the mother and the child are healthy…”       He also shared his daughter's photograph in another post.Mr Mann married Gurpreet Kaur in 2022. He was previously married to Inderpreet Kaur, with whom he has one son and a daughter. They were divorced in 2015. That custody ends today, and the probe agency has sought a further seven days to continue questioning the Aam Aadmi Party leader.


Earlier today a defiant Mr Kejriwal rose to address the court directly, and accused the probe agency of trying "to crush" his party. Mr Kejriwal pointed out - as the AAP has since his arrest - no part of the alleged ₹ 100 crore in bribes had been recovered. He also said no court had found him guilty.


"I was arrested... but no court has proved me guilty. The CBI (Central Bureau of Investigation) has filed 31,000 pages (of chargesheets) and ED filed 25,000 pages. Even if you read them together... the question remains... why have I been arrested?" Mr Kejriwal asked the court.


What Arvind Kejriwal Told The Court


Given just a few minutes to speak, the AAP leader also said his name only figured four times in those tens of thousands of pages, and that one of those four was C Arvind and not Arvind Kejriwal.


 


 

 


C Arvind was ex-Deputy Chief Minister Manish Sisodia's secretary, and he has told the authorities that Mr Sisodia - who was arrested in this case in February - handed over "some documents".


"My name came just four times... and once it was 'C Arvind'. He said that in his presence Sisodiaji gave me some documents. But MLAs came to my house daily... to give me files, to discuss the government. Is a statement like this enough to arrest a sitting Chief Minister?" he asked.


The AAP leader had been expected to make a big revelation in this case; last evening his wife, Sunita Kejriwal, declared her husband would offer insights into the location of the alleged ₹ 100 crore.

In court today, Mr Kejriwal referred to the statements of approvers, or government witnesses, who had earlier been arrested in this case, suggesting they had been coerced into accusing him.


"The ED had only one mission - to trap me," he alleged, "Three statements were given (by one witness)... but the court only saw those that accused me. Why? This is not right."


Another witness, he said, had given six statements that did not name the Chief Minister, but he was released after a seventh that did so. "If there really is a scam of 100 crore... where is the money?"


The Chief Minister also referred to a third witness - Sarath Reddy - who he claimed had donated ₹ 50 crore to the BJP. "I have proof... that they are running a racket," he declared.
